Pick to Light and Put to Light Systems

Visual Indicator-Based Picking and Sorting for Fast, Reliable Execution

Fast, Visual Execution Systems for Order Assembly, Kitting, and Replenishment

Our Pick to Light and Put to Light systems simplify warehouse operations by using light signals to guide workers in picking and placing items. Integrated with ERP/WMS picklists, the process begins by scanning the picklist, which then directs tasks through the light indicators. These systems boost accuracy and speed, making them ideal for high-volume tasks. Easy to use and integrate, they help reduce errors and enhance order fulfilment, significantly improving efficiency.

Key Features

High Accuracy

Light indicators guide operators to the correct items or locations, reducing picking and putting errors.

Increased Efficiency

Speeds up both picking and sorting processes, ensuring quicker order fulfilment.

User-Friendly Interface

Easy-to-use design allows for quick training and minimal onboarding time.

Scalable Integration

Compatible with warehouse management systems (WMS), allowing seamless integration into existing operations.

Real-Time Tracking

Offers real-time visibility into the picking and putting processes, enhancing inventory management.

Customisable Configuration

Flexible setup options to meet the specific needs of different warehouse layouts and operational workflows.
